怎么选智能汽车域控制器芯片
1. 控制类芯片介绍
自动驾驶芯片是指可实现高级别自动驾驶的 SoC 芯片。CPU作为通用处理器,适用于处理数量适中的复杂运算。
控制类芯片主要就是指MCU(Microcontroller Unit),即微控制器,又叫单片机,是把CPU的主频与规格做适当缩减,并将存储器、定时器、A/D转换、时钟、I/O端口及串行通讯等多种功能模块和接口集成在单个芯片上,实现终端控制的功能,具有性能高、功耗低、可编程、灵活度高等优点。
汽车是MCU的一个非常重要的应用领域,据IC Insights数据,2019年全球MCU应用于汽车电子的占比约为33%。高端车型中每辆车用到的MCU数量接近100个,从行车电脑、液晶仪表,到发动机、底盘,汽车中大大小小的组件都需要MCU进行把控。早期,汽车中应用的主要是8位和16位MCU,但随着汽车电子化和智能化不断加强,所需要的MCU数量与质量也不断提高。当前,32位MCU在汽车MCU中的占比已经达到了约60%,其中ARM公司的Cortex系列内核,因其成本低廉,功耗控制优异,是各汽车MCU厂商的主流选择。
汽车MCU的主要参数包括工作电压、运行主频、Flash和RAM容量、定时器模块和通道数量、ADC模块和通道数量、串行通讯接口种类和数量、输入输出I/O口数量、工作温度、封装形式及功能安全等级等。
按CPU位数划分,汽车MCU主要可分为8位、16位和32位。随着工艺升级,32位MCU成本不断下降,目前已经成为主流,正在逐渐替代过去由8/16位MCU主导的应用和市场。
如果按应用领域划分,汽车MCU又可以分为车身域、动力域、底盘域、座舱域和智驾域。其中,对于座舱域和智驾域来说,MCU需要有较高的运算能力,并具有高速的外部通讯接口,比如CAN FD和以太网,车身域同样要求有较多的外部通讯接口数量,但对MCU的算力要求相对较低,而动力域和底盘域则要求更高的工作温度和功能安全等级。